What is Waiver of Premium Rider in Child Plans?

What are Riders? 

When it comes to purchasing a child's insurance policy, Riders are the most important part. Riders are the special options which you can add to supplement your Life Insurance Policy by just paying an extra premium. There are a wide array of riders available that you can add to your insurance policy.

Riders provide you accidental death benefit, family income benefit along with many more benefits. However, the waiver of premium rider is the most important rider to opt with a child plan. If in case something unfortunate happens and it makes a policy holder disabled or injured, the waiver of premium rider will keep your policy intact and take care of the future premiums to be paid. Premiums would be paid by the insurance company as long as you remain disabled as per the terms and conditions of the policy. 

List of Common Riders Opted WIth Child Plans

There are common life insurance riders which you can include with your child plan:

1. Accidental death & Disability Benefit 

This Rider offers an additional death and disability benefit to the nominees of the policy or you if in case of unforeseen situation that leads to death or if you lose a limb or get disabled. 

2. Child Term Rider 

This Rider provides a benefit of essential expenses in the case of the demise of the child before the particular age. 

3. Critical Illness Rider

This Rider provides coverage for a predefined illness in the policy. 

4. Term Conversion Rider

This Rider allows you the flexibility for the conversion of a term policy into a whole policy at the end of the policy period. 

5. Income Benefit Rider

It makes the child eligible to receive 1% sum assured of the rider every month in the circumstances of death of the parent, permanent disability of the parent, parents having any specified illness pre defined in the policy.
